PostgreSQL中非空约束如何创建声明

这篇文章主要介绍了PostgreSQL中非空约束如何创建声明的相关知识,内容详细易懂,操作简单快捷,具有一定借鉴价值,相信大家阅读完这篇PostgreSQL中非空约束如何创建声明文章都会有所收获,下面我们一起来看看吧。

非空约束

一个非空约束仅仅指定一个列中不会有空值,非空约束等价于检查约束(column_name is not null)。

非空约束创建声明

在变量后加上NOT NULL即可声明。

(
...
列名 变量类型 NOT NULL,
...
)

声明一个字段必须不能为NULL,非空约束总是被写成“字段约束”。

 CREATE TABLE books (
  id int NOT NULL,
  name varchar(20),
  price int
);

关于“PostgreSQL中非空约束如何创建声明”这篇文章的内容就介绍到这里,感谢各位的阅读!

相关文章

项目需要,有个数据需要导入,拿到手一开始以为是mysql,结果...
本文小编为大家详细介绍“怎么查看PostgreSQL数据库中所有表...
错误现象问题原因这是在远程连接时pg_hba.conf文件没有配置正...
因本地资源有限,在公共测试环境搭建了PGsql环境,从数据库本...
wamp 环境 这个提示就是说你的版本低于10了。 先打印ph...
psycopg2.OperationalError: SSL SYSCALL error: EOF detect...